Beach parties send Goa back to lockdown

- India

India’s sunshine state of Goa was the latest to be forced back into lockdown yesterday as coronaviru­s infections are rising rapidly throughout the country. New cases surged by a record 41,857 yesterday, according to the World Health Organisati­on, taking India’s national total to 968,876. The health ministry reported 680 deaths in a day, another record. Goa declared a state-wide three-day lockdown yesterday and imposed an evening curfew for the next month, barely a fortnight after announcing that its beaches were reopening for tourism.
